TNI Asserts No Impunity for Paspampres Member Committing Murder

Jakarta Military Police (Pomdam Jaya) named a member of the Presidential Security Unit (Paspampres) Private RM and two members of the Indonesian Military (TNI) as suspects in the alleged abduction and murder of Imam Masykur, a Bireun Aceh native living in Jakarta.

The Indonesian Army spokesperson Brigadier General Hamim Tohari assured that there would be no impunity or exemption from punishment for the Paspampres member Private RM, the TNI member of the Topography Directorate Private HS, and the TNI member of the Iskandar Muda Military Command Private J.

TNI Commander Admiral Yudo Margono had previously stressed that the Indonesian Military would not grant impunity to members violating the law. Yudo said that there was no impunity in the alleged bribery case involving the Head of the National Search and Rescue Agency (Basarnas) and the case of Major Dedi Hasibuan who raided the Medan Sector Police Post on Saturday, August 5, 2023.

“There is no impunity, no cover-up, none. I have said that we take stern action against soldiers who commit violations,” the TNI Commander said on August 7, 2023.
